-1

Magento 1.7,Qmail 作为 smtp,并行 plesk 10.3,Centos

由于几天我的一个magento安装没有发送电子邮件,这个问题只影响一个magento安装。

异常日志报告:

2013-10-14T15:05:41+00:00 ERR (3):
exception 'Zend_Mail_Transport_Exception' with message 'Unable to send mail. ' in /var/www/vhosts/domain.ext/httpdocs/lib/Zend/Mail/Transport/Sendmail.php:137
 Stack trace:
#0 /var/www/vhosts/domain.ext/httpdocs/lib/Zend/Mail/Transport/Abstract.php(348): Zend_Mail_Transport_Sendmail->_sendMail()
#1 /var/www/vhosts/domain.ext/httpdocs/lib/Zend/Mail.php(1194): Zend_Mail_Transport_Abstract->send(Object(Zend_Mail))
 #2 /var/www/vhosts/domain.ext/httpdocs/app/code/core/Mage/Core/Model/Email/Template.php(454): Zend_Mail->send()
#3 /var/www/vhosts/domain.ext/httpdocs/app/code/core/Mage/Core/Model/Email/Template.php(506): Mage_Core_Model_Email_Template->send(Array, Array, Array)
#4 /var/www/vhosts/domain.ext/httpdocs/app/code/core/Mage/Core/Model/Email/Template/Mailer.php(79): Mage_Core_Model_Email_Template->sendTransactional('sales_email_ord...', 'sales', Array, Array, Array, '5')
 #5 /var/www/vhosts/domain.ext/httpdocs/app/code/core/Mage/Sales/Model/Order.php(1393): Mage_Core_Model_Email_Template_Mailer->send()
 #6 /var/www/vhosts/domain.ext/httpdocs/app/code/core/Mage/Adminhtml/controllers/Sales/OrderController.php(276): Mage_Sales_Model_Order->sendOrderUpdateEmail('1', 'test')
 #7 /var/www/vhosts//domain.ext/httpdocs/app/code/core/Mage/Core/Controller/Varien/Action.php(419): Mage_Adminhtml_Sales_OrderController->addCommentAction()
 #8 /var/www/vhosts//domain.ext/httpdocs/app/code/core/Mage/Core/Controller/Varien/Router/Standard.php(250): Mage_Core_Controller_Varien_Action->dispatch('addComment')
 #9 /var/www/vhosts/domain.ext/httpdocs/app/code/core/Mage/Core/Controller/Varien/Front.php(176): Mage_Core_Controller_Varien_Router_Standard->match(Object(Mage_Core_Controller_Request_Http))
 #10 /var/www/vhosts/domain.ext/httpdocs/app/code/core/Mage/Core/Model/App.php(354): Mage_Core_Controller_Varien_Front->dispatch()
 #11 /var/www/vhosts/domain.ext/httpdocs/app/Mage.php(683): Mage_Core_Model_App->run(Array)
#12 /var/www/vhosts/domain.ext/httpdocs/index.php(87): Mage::run('', 'store')
#13 {main}

qmail 包装器显示没有问题的电子邮件标题 mail.log 中没有错误

error.log 报告:

 qmail-inject: fatal: unable to parse this line:
 From: Global-seller: e-commerce <senderemail> 

*(senderemail =正确的magento电子邮件)*

服务器上的 smtp 运行良好(所有其他域都在发送电子邮件) 安装在具有不同域的同一服务器上的其他 magento 没有问题。magento 设置在端口 25 上配置为 localhost

服务器上没有安装 postfix

有小费吗?谢谢

4

1 回答 1

0

我猜这是因为 from name 设置为“Global-seller: e-commerce”。额外的冒号可能会把它扔掉。– aynber 17 分钟前

是的,已解决,谢谢 – user1847437 13 分钟前

于 2013-10-14T16:12:58.403 回答